Handover — PinPoint autocomplete widget

For: release manager, v3.2 cut.

State: suggestion ranking fixed, debounce at 180ms, Kestrelford region cache warmed. Known issue: apartment-number parsing still off in edge cases; ticket filed. Don't ship without the geocoder flag on. Staging creds rotated Friday. The config vault for the widget's signing keys relocks on deploy — unlock it with the phrase below before the release pipeline runs.

vault phrase of bagaf-kajeg = jorath-feniel-briir-siliel-ralix

Handover note — Crumbwheel order cutoffs.

Welcome aboard. The bakery cutoff rule in Crumbwheel closes same-day orders at 14:00 local to each storefront, not UTC — this has bitten us twice. Holiday overrides live in the calendar service and take precedence silently, so always check there first when a cutoff looks wrong. To unlock the calendar service's admin console after a restart, enter the recovery passphrase below.

vault phrase of bagap-bahaf = silion-pelox-sorox-casdor-quenwyn-fraax-eliox-praael-kelion-quenvan-kasox-rusael-norius-belvan

Meeting notes — weekly cash-box run, Thursday briefing. Attendees: Marlen Voss (driver coordination), Tibo Haren (branch liaison). The Keldermark branch run moves to 09:40 to avoid the market-day closures on Aldwyn Row. Boxes must be sealed and logged against the Fenwick tally sheet before loading, and the spare seal kit stays in the cab at all times. Marlen confirmed the relief driver has completed the route walkthrough. The courier hand-over instruction for this week is as follows.

courier memo of yawep-yafog: the pramir ulaix courier leaves the ulavan aldix frair zorok oliiel joreth rusdor fenvan ledger at gate 1305 under passcode 514738

## Ownership

The fan-out backpressure layer in Heraldic throttles notification dispatch when downstream queues exceed the watermark thresholds defined in the pacing config. Changes to watermark values, shed policies, or the priority lanes must be reviewed before the weekly deploy window. Please raise concerns at the eng sync rather than in ad-hoc threads. The accountable owner is listed below.

named custodian: Zorok Briir Novvan